Loading / Saving Data from Files

To input a hullform from an offset file select the Load button. A dialog box will appear that allows you to select the offsets file to be used.

For Section data the offsets must be held in the Britfair format. The default file extension is BRI, which is the default file extension for Britfair files. This may changed using the File Type list at the bottom right of the dialog. After successfully importing a hullform the program will display all the sections for inspection.

For Stem and Stern data the points must be held in X and Z column format. The default file extension is .DAT.

If you have entered a series of offsets by hand or by using the digitizer you may wish to save them in a file. From the main dialog press Save As, supply a file name and your data will be saved. The data will be in Britfair format for Sections and X & Z format for the Stem and Stern.
Having altered a file of offsets, the changes can simply be saved in the file by pressing Save.
